Understanding Solar Halos

Have you ever gazed at the sky and noticed a magical ring around the sun? Solar halos are awe-inspiring yet seldom seen phenomena. They can occur when sunlight interacts with the ice crystals found in cirrus clouds. This incredible interplay creates a vibrant halo effect, often capturing the attention of those lucky enough to spot it. The Science Behind the Wonder

What causes this ethereal beauty? Scientists explain that halo formation is a result of light refraction and reflection. Sunlight passes through hexagon-shaped ice crystals, bending and scattering the light. This science results in stunning displays of color, often resembling a watercolor painting.
